Dreamflow: A Windsurf Alternative for responsive web apps and cross-platform mobile products that benefit from visual editing, code export, and iterative AI scaffolding

Dreamflow is a AI app builder built for founders, designers, product teams, and builders who want one workflow that mixes prompts, visual editing, code access, and cross-platform deployment across web and mobile. As a Windsurf alternative, it is best suited for teams that want responsive web apps and cross-platform mobile products that benefit from visual editing, code export, and iterative AI scaffolding instead of an IDE-first coding workflow.

Key Strengths

  • It combines prompt, visual, and code editing in one loop: Lovable is simpler because it keeps the workflow more prompt-first and product-centric. Dreamflow is more flexible when the team wants to move between AI generation, visual adjustments, and direct code control without switching tools.
  • It is stronger for cross-platform ambition: Dreamflow can deploy to Web, iOS, and Android, which makes it more attractive when the project is not purely a web MVP. Lovable is usually the cleaner choice when the product is web-only and the team wants less surface-area complexity.
  • It offers a more balanced designer-developer bridge: The visual canvas matters. Teams that want a builder where product, design, and code perspectives stay connected may find Dreamflow more collaborative than Lovable, even if it also asks more from the user.

Known Limitations

  • Limitation 1: It is less obvious than Lovable for completely non-technical founders who only want the fastest path to one web app.
  • Limitation 2: The Flutter and cross-platform orientation can be overkill for teams that do not care about mobile or code-level control.
  • Limitation 3: Public pricing is clear, but the jump from $20 Hobby to $90 Pro is meaningful once version control and heavier production workflow become necessary.

Pricing

  • Free: Free plan at $0 per month with 10 starter credits and web deployment
  • Paid: Hobby starts at $20 per month with full code export and mobile deployment; Pro is $90 per month with Git and premium-model access; Enterprise is custom
  • Notes: Dreamflow's pricing is refreshingly explicit for a newer AI builder, with clear Free, Hobby, Pro, and Enterprise levels instead of vague usage-only messaging.

When to Choose This Over Windsurf

  • Choose Dreamflow when the app may need to ship on web and mobile, not only on the web.
  • Choose it when your team wants AI generation plus a real visual canvas and code surface in one synced workflow.
  • Choose it when designers and developers both need to touch the product without abandoning the AI-builder loop.

When Windsurf May Be a Better Fit

  • Windsurf is a better fit when your work starts from a repository, needs terminal tooling, or demands agentic code edits instead of a managed builder.
  • Windsurf stays stronger for debugging, refactoring, and bespoke software engineering that goes beyond the boundaries of a visual app platform.
  • Windsurf is also the safer default when the team wants code-first flexibility earlier than this builder naturally offers.

Conclusion

External coverage tends to praise Dreamflow for combining AI speed, visual control, and code-level access in a way that feels more production-aware than many demo-first AI builders. The common caution is complexity: it shines more when the team actually needs that extra breadth.

Dreamflow makes the most sense when the real job is shipping an app experience, not accelerating a terminal-centered engineering loop. If you need repo control, debugging depth, and agentic code edits more than a managed builder, Windsurf remains the more honest choice.

Workflow Notes

Dreamflow also changes the working relationship between developers and non-developers. Product managers, founders, and designers can usually contribute earlier because the interface exposes visual state, deployment ideas, and app behavior more directly than an IDE does.

That does not automatically make the platform better. It means the tradeoff should be judged against your team structure: if the project needs shared visibility and faster app iteration, the builder workflow becomes a benefit; if it needs unrestricted engineering control, the same abstraction becomes friction.

Migration Questions Teams Should Ask

Before switching from Windsurf to Dreamflow, the team should decide whether it is replacing a coding workflow or adding a faster app-shipping layer on top of one. That question matters because many disappointments with AI builders come from expecting them to behave like IDE agents once the project grows beyond the initial prototype.

The safest path is usually to define a small product slice, ship it, and then judge how much of the resulting app still belongs inside the builder. If the platform keeps helping after the first launch, it is a good sign; if the team immediately wants lower-level control, Windsurf or another code-first environment should stay central.

Operational Tradeoffs

Dreamflow can reduce setup friction, but it also concentrates more decisions inside one platform. Billing, deployment, collaboration, and data architecture may become easier to start with, yet they can also become more opinionated than a developer-centered IDE workflow.

That is why this comparison should be read as a workflow choice rather than a raw feature race. Windsurf helps teams write and maintain code faster, while Dreamflow helps teams turn product ideas into app surfaces faster. Those are adjacent goals, not identical ones.
